Enhancing Employee Retention with AI

The rise of artificial intelligence (AI) has posed a major challenge to employers when it comes to enhancing employee retention. AI has the potential to replace many traditional job roles, and it has become increasingly difficult to retain valued employees in the face of this technological advancement. While the threat of AI replacing human labor is a real concern, there is also great potential for employers to use AI to their advantage in order to enhance employee retention.

AI-powered HRMS tools enable companies to automate mundane HR tasks such as payroll processing, employee onboarding, and time tracking. This allows HR teams to spend less time on tedious administrative tasks and more time on developing strategies that will help the organization reach its business goals. AI-powered HRMS tools also provide better insight into employee performance and engagement, allowing HR teams to identify areas where improvement is needed.

AI-powered HRMS tools can also help to improve the quality of employee engagement. AI-powered tools can monitor employee engagement, identify areas of concern, and provide personalized feedback and recommendations. This can help to create a more positive working environment and improve employee morale. AI can be used to make the recruitment process more efficient and effective. By using AI-based algorithms, employers can quickly identify the best candidates for a role based on their skills, experience and qualifications. This can help to reduce time to fill, enabling employers to select the best candidates faster and make offers more quickly. In addition, AI-based tools can be used to identify the most suitable roles for potential employees, ensuring that they are placed in the right job where they are most likely to succeed. AI can also be used to improve onboarding and training processes. AI-based tools can provide personalized learning paths to new employees, enabling them to quickly develop the skills they need to be successful in their new role. AI can be used to analyze employee feedback to identify potential issues or areas of improvement and make relevant changes to the onboarding process.

AI can also be used to identify potential areas of employee dissatisfaction, such as inadequate pay or lack of career development. By using AI-based algorithms, employers can quickly identify the root cause of employee dissatisfaction and take steps to address it. This can help to ensure that employees are satisfied and motivated in their roles, and are less likely to leave the organization.

AI-powered HRMS tools can also help to reduce the cost of hiring, onboarding and training new employees. AI-powered tools can be used to streamline the recruitment process, shortening the time it takes to find and hire the perfect candidate. AI-powered tools can also help to reduce the cost of onboarding, as they can automate and streamline the paperwork process. AI-powered tools also enable HR teams to quickly create personalized training materials and job descriptions, which can help to reduce the cost of onboarding and training new employees.

AI can also be used to identify high-performing employees and reward them for their hard work. By analyzing employee performance, employers can quickly identify employees who are excelling in their roles and provide them with rewards and recognition. This can help to keep employees motivated and engaged in their roles, which in turn can help to enhance employee retention.

AI can be used to monitor employee engagement and provide feedback on how to improve it. By using AI-based algorithms, employers can identify areas of improvement and make relevant changes to the work environment. This can help to create a more positive and engaging workplace and make employees more likely to stay in their role.
